  • Manufacturing processes of a multilayer web are known from prior art, in which processes, in order to return wire waters, in connection with multilayer head boxes the wire water from a wire section is passed to that layer of the head box from where it originally came from.
  • European patent application 0 664 356 discloses a method and an apparatus for improving the quality of multilayer papers, in which arrangement the waters from the former are divided into parts so that the waters from the surface layers are supplied in the multilayer headbox onto surface layers and the waters from the middle layers are passed to the middle layer.
  • Finnish patent application 992670 discloses a method for the manufacture of a multilayer web and a multilayer former having two formers, at least the other headbox being a multilayer headbox, and the wire waters being collected from the former such that the waters from the surface layers are passed to the surface layers in the headbox and the waters from the middle layers are passed to the middle layer.
  • recycled fiber material recycled fiber contains other materials of various kinds, e.g. box treating agent, surface treating agent such as wax, bitumen and different dirt particles, etc. generated in the treatment of rubbers and adhesive tapes, which particles form stickies.
  • box treating agent e.g. wax, bitumen and different dirt particles, etc. generated in the treatment of rubbers and adhesive tapes, which particles form stickies.
  • a particular problem is that, when recycled fiber is used in the manufacture of paper/board pulp, without the expensive additional processes of the type described above, both the machine and the end product will be subjected to problems caused by detrimental materials coming from the raw materials.
  • problems are caused especially by dirt particles conveyed with the recycled fiber when passing the wire waters via short circulation to be used again.
  • different particles, stickies, e.g. waxes and bitumen originating from the recycled fiber raw material stick to machine parts.   • An object of the invention is thus to reduce the amount of energy used in the processing.
  • An object of the invention is to reduce the effects of the detrimental materials conveyed with recycled fibers in the paper or board machine and in the end product.
  • An object of the invention is to provide a solution in order to eliminate or at least minimize the above-described problems.
  • the wire water discharging from the forming of the middle layer is supplied to the surface layer, and the water discharging from the forming of the surface layer and containing stickies and other detrimental materials is passed to be used in the forming of the middle layer, and the water discharging from the forming of the back layer is returned to the back layer.
  • fresh water is supplied to the surface and the dirtier waters as well as the stickies and other detrimental materials are supplied to the back.
  • stickies and other detrimental materials conveyed with the water flows are passed to layers where they cause fewer problems.
  • the harmful effects of unwanted matter such as stickies and bitumen can be reduced e.g. on the surfaces of a fibrous web product.
  • This in turn makes it possible to decrease the amount of additional processes such as dispersing in the manufacture.
  • the process of the invention is devised and designed in a new way giving further new opportunities to optimize the process and the end product what comes, for example, to the filler used as the raw material of a desired layer.
  • An advantage achieved thus in the invention is the relocation of couplings performed in the process. Forming serves as part of the cleaning process and at the same time new functions are provided in the wire section.

  • a pulp tower containing middle-length fiber has the reference number 10, that containing short fiber the reference number 20 and that containing long fiber the reference number 30.
  • the pulp is pumped by means of a feed pump 11, 21, 31 to a machine chest 12, 22, 32.
  • the pulp is passed to a mixer 13, 23, 33.
  • Overflow of the screen 12, 22, 32 of the machine chest is passed back to the corresponding pulp tower 10, 20, 30.
  • the pulp that came from the pulp tower 10, 20, 30 via the screen 12, 22, 32 of the machine chest is diluted with wire water taken from a wire water pit 17, 27 37 into headbox consistency and passed further via a screen 14, 24, 34 to a head- box 15, 25, 35.
  • the pulp suspension is fed from the headboxes 15, 25, 35 to a wire section 16, 26, 36, where the web being formed is dewatered.
  • the web being formed in the wire section 16 is passed to be used as the back layer of the web being formed.
  • the web being formed in the wire section 26 is passed to be used as the middle layer of the web being formed and the web being formed in the wire section 36 is passed to be used as the surface layer of the web being formed.
  • the wire water removed from the web is passed from the wire section 16, 26, 36 to the respective wire water pit 17, 27 and 37.
  • the overflow of the wire water pit 17, 27, 37 is passed via a container 18, 28, 38 to the pulp tower 10, 20, 30 or to be discharged, and the wire water of the back layer from the wire water pit 17 is passed back to the mixer 13 leading to the headbox layer 15 of the back layer.
  • the wire water of the middle layer from the wire water tank 27 is passed to the mixer 33 leading to the surface layer.
  • the wire water is passed to the mixer 23 of the middle layer.
  • Figure 2 differs from that of Figure 1 in that from the wire water pit 17 of the back layer the wire water is passed to a channel leading to the mixer 23 of the middle layer. From the wire water pit 27 of the middle layer the wire water is passed to a channel leading to the mixer 33 of the surface layer, and from the wire water pit 37 of the surface layer the wire water is passed to a channel leading to the mixer 13 of the surface layer.
  • Figure 3 differs from the above-described embodiments in that from the wire water pit 27 of the middle layer the wire water is passed to the mixer 13 of the back layer. From the wire water pit 17 of the back layer the wire water is passed to the mixer 33 of the surface layer, and from the wire water pit 37 of the surface layer the wire water is passed to the mixer 23 of the middle layer as in the embodiment according to Figure 1.
  • the stickies are passed, at least partially, with the wire water to the desired layer, preferably to the middle layer, to the back layer, in necessary.
  • the stickies will thus not be conveyed to the surface layer and do not stick to machine parts or cause surface defects in the finished web.
  • the screened, fresh water is supplied to the surface, the dirtiest water to the middle and the semi-dirty water to the back layer.
  • the embodiments shown in Figures 1-3 relate to the manufacture of a three-layer web, but when manufacturing a two-layer web, for example, the surface layer is supplied with the fresh water and the back with the dirtier waters.

Abstract

La présente invention concerne un procédé de fabrication d'une bande de papier ou de carton multicouches contenant des fibres recyclées. Ledit procédé consiste à former la bande multicouches constituée d'au moins deux couches à compositions de pâte différentes et à diluer la pulpe lors de la formation de chaque couche avec de l'eau de toile pour obtenir la consistance de la caisse de papier, puis, à l'acheminer au moyen de ladite caisse jusqu'à une section de toile, la bande étant ensuite déshydratée. Enfin, ledit procédé consiste à joindre ces couches en vue de former une bande multicouches. Ce procédé comprend une étape de passage de l'eau de toile éliminée de la section de toile lors de la formation de chaque couche à utiliser dans la dilution d'une puple d'une autre couche à acheminer.
